Obama Hints Veep Is a “He”

RALEIGH, N.C. — 8:25 p.m. EDT

It wasn’t much, but Obama said “he” when asked at a town hall here just now about his unnamed vice presidential nominee.

Obama didn’t reveal any names (of course), but when describing the characteristics of his running mate, Obama usedthe word “he” three times when discussing the running mate’s approach to governing in an Obama White House.

Among the possible running mates for Obama are two women: New York Sen. Hillary Clinton and Kansas Gov. Kathleen Sebelius.

After saying his vice president will not, as he implied vice President Cheney had, exercise undue influence on foreign and domestic policy, Obama said of his vice president: “I won’t have my vice president engineer foreign policy for me. The buck will stop with me, because I will be the president. My vice president, also, by the way, my vice president will be a member of the executive branch. He won’t be one of these 4th branches of government where he thinks he’s above the law.”

The second and third uses of “he” could well have been Obama talking about Cheney. the first one, however, could not be so interpreted.
In his long answer about the qualities he was looking for, the junior senator from Illinois said he was looking for “somebody” or “someone,” but the slipped reference to “he” caught the ears of reporters and Obama’s traveling press staff.

“I heard it,” said traveling spokeswoman Jen Psaki. “I don’t think it means anything.”

We shall see.
